How To Write Resume For Head Transfer Clerk

  • Highlight your skills and experience in wire transfer processing, ACH processing, and foreign exchange transactions.
  • Showcase your ability to manage a team and improve operational efficiency.
  • Quantify your accomplishments with specific metrics and results.
  • Demonstrate your commitment to customer service and compliance.
  • Use keywords relevant to the job title and industry, such as ‘wire transfer’, ‘ACH’, ‘compliance’, and ‘customer service’.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Head Transfer Clerk

  • What are the key responsibilities of a Head Transfer Clerk?

    The key responsibilities of a Head Transfer Clerk include managing a team of clerks, developing and implementing new processes to improve efficiency, collaborating with stakeholders to resolve transfer issues, reconciling bank statements, monitoring transfer activity, providing exceptional customer service, and adhering to security protocols and compliance regulations.

  • What skills and experience are required for a Head Transfer Clerk?

    Head Transfer Clerks should have skills and experience in wire transfer processing, ACH processing, foreign exchange transactions, bank reconciliation, customer service, and attention to detail. They should also be proficient in utilizing electronic transfer systems and software applications.

  • What is the career path for a Head Transfer Clerk?

    Head Transfer Clerks can advance to positions such as Operations Manager, Branch Manager, or Treasury Manager. They may also specialize in a particular area of transfer operations, such as wire transfer or foreign exchange.

  • What is the salary range for a Head Transfer Clerk?

    The salary range for a Head Transfer Clerk varies depending on factors such as experience, location, and company size. According to Salary.com, the average salary for a Head Transfer Clerk in the United States is $65,000.

  • What are the job prospects for Head Transfer Clerks?

    The job prospects for Head Transfer Clerks are expected to be good in the coming years. The increasing volume of electronic transfers and the globalization of businesses are driving demand for skilled transfer professionals.

  • What are the challenges faced by Head Transfer Clerks?

    Head Transfer Clerks may face challenges such as managing a high volume of transactions, ensuring compliance with regulations, and resolving complex transfer issues. They must also be able to adapt to new technologies and changes in the financial industry.

  • What is the work environment for Head Transfer Clerks?

    Head Transfer Clerks typically work in a fast-paced and demanding environment. They must be able to work independently and as part of a team. They may also be required to work overtime, especially during peak periods.
